Classic Singles and Doubles TournamentsThe most straightforward way to integrate foosball into a birthday party is through a structured tournament. Traditional singles matches offer a intense, head-to-head test of skill and reflexes, perfect for the more competitive guests. However, for a birthday setting, doubles matches usually steal the show. Teaming up forces communication, leads to hilarious accidental own-goals, and doubles the number of people actively playing.

Setting up a simple bracket on a whiteboard creates an instant focal point for the party. You can run a quick single-elimination tournament where the winner stays on, or a round-robin format to ensure everyone gets plenty of playtime. To elevate the birthday atmosphere, consider awarding a silly trophy or a themed prize to the winning duo. The drama of a final match, with a crowd gathered around the table cheering on every block and strike, creates lasting memories.

Speed Foosball and Multi-Ball MayhemFor parties with a large guest list or younger crowds with shorter attention spans, traditional rules might feel a bit too slow. This is where speed foosball variations come into play. One popular twist is the time-attack mode, where matches are strictly limited to two minutes. Whoever has the most goals when the timer buzzes wins the round. This format keeps the rotation fast, ensuring no one spends too much time waiting in line.

If you want to inject pure chaos into the celebration, try multi-ball mayhem. Instead of playing with a single ball, drop three or four balls onto the playing surface simultaneously. The game instantly turns into a frantic, fast-paced blur of spinning rods and unpredictable deflections. This variation completely levels the playing field, making it less about precise skill and entirely about quick reflexes and luck, which often results in fits of uncontrollable laughter.

The Rotation Relay ChallengeTo involve even more people in a single game, the rotation relay is an excellent choice. In this mode, two large teams are formed, but only two or four players are at the table at any given time. Every time a goal is scored, or at set thirty-second intervals, the current players must immediately step away from the table, and the next teammates in line must jump in and take over the handles without stopping the action.

This format requires teamwork, quick transitions, and constant focus from everyone in the room. Guests who are waiting for their turn are just as engaged as the ones playing, shouting instructions and preparing to dive into the action. It breaks down social barriers rapidly, making it an ideal icebreaker if the birthday guest list includes different friend groups or relatives who do not know each other well.
